Jha said the key member of now disbanded Team Anna is not a leader but "an activist doing politics of swadeshi with foreign funding".
Taking part in a rally here organised by Bharatiya Janata Yuva Morcha yesterday, he said, "Kejriwal is not fit for politics, where he will be like a fused bulb."
Kejriwal, a Magsaysay Award winner, is more of an "activist who is doing politics of swadeshi with foreign funding", the BJP leader maintained.
The bureaucrat-turned-RTI activist and some other members of the erstwhile Team Anna have decided to form a political party.
